‘Am I watching Daniel Sturridge or Torres at Chelsea in disguise?’ – Twitter Explodes And Reacts On The Awful Performance Of Sturridge

Liverpool’s second half of the season certainly is not going well and with the club out of the EFL Cup, more questions are being asked about the players at Merseyside. While the likes of Jordan Henderson and Emre Can have been bashed a number of times this season, another player is on the radar of the Liverpool fans.

Daniel Sturridge finally got a chance to show the world what he can do for Jurgen Klopp’s side but the striker failed once again in the EFL Cup and the fans did take to Twitter to show their lack of belief in the 27-year-old.

The former Chelsea and Manchester City striker was compared to another former fallen great at the club, Fernando Torres. The Spaniard picked up a number of injuries during the latter half of his Liverpool career and was sold to Chelsea for a crazy amount of money but he had already lost his spark back then.

Sturridge could turn out to be another Torres situation. The player doesn’t look sharp like he was a few years ago and is ill-suited to the system that Klopp employs at Liverpool. Twitter was scathing on the Englishman especially after the 1-0 loss in the EFL Cup game against the Saints at Anfield.

The striker did have a couple of golden chances to give Liverpool the lead but he was wasteful and his time at Anfield could be coming to an end as well.
